Hello,

I'm very much an SNMP noob, but I would like to implement a subagent for a
custom device.  I'm running into an issue while trying to do the agentx
subagent tutorial[1]  where I get the following error:

> net-snmp-config --cflags
Can not find "/usr/include/net-snmp/net-snmp-config.h". The net-snmp
development files seems to be missing. Exiting
-DNETSNMP_ENABLE_IPV6 -fmessage-length=0 -O2 -Wall -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2
-fstack-protector -funwind-tables -fasynchronous-unwind-tables -g
-fno-strict-aliasing -fstack-protector-all -Ulinux -Dlinux=linux
-I/usr/include/rpm -D_REENTRANT -D_GNU_SOURCE -DPERL_USE_SAFE_PUTENV
-DDEBUGGING -fno-strict-aliasing -pipe -D_LARGEFILE_SOURCE
-D_FILE_OFFSET_BITS=64
-I/usr/lib/perl5/5.10.0/x86_64-linux-thread-multi/CORE -I. -I/usr/include

I'm running on S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 11 SP 3, and I'm using the
following rpms:

snmp-mibs-5.4.2.1-8.12.20.1
perl-SNMP-5.4.2.1-8.12.20.1
libsnmp15-5.4.2.1-8.12.20.1
net-snmp-5.4.2.1-8.12.20.1

I would like to be able to use the provided rpm for the server if possible.
 Is there a way to avoid having to install from source perhaps by
'reconstructing' the necessary headers?
